Output e39131676c8a698432b2566d1a3ca81a04f23c26ce561e13cb9f55e4c93d580f:0

value
3580238
script pubkey
OP_0 OP_PUSHBYTES_20 2d5d4f290603801e54e9b02adce402a1331f481d
address
bc1q94w572gxqwqpu48fkq4deeqz5ye37jqa5cr48s
transaction
e39131676c8a698432b2566d1a3ca81a04f23c26ce561e13cb9f55e4c93d580f
spent
true